1. Blockchain and Its Core Components

At its core, a blockchain is a distributed ledger system. It maintains a growing list of records (blocks), secured through cryptographic techniques. Each block is linked to the previous one, creating a tamper-proof chain of data.

Core Elements:

  • Nodes: Participants that maintain the blockchain by validating transactions.
  • Consensus Mechanisms: Protocols like Proof of Work (PoW) or Proof of Stake (PoS) that ensure agreement on transaction validity.
  • Smart Contracts: Self-executing contracts with rules encoded into the blockchain.

These components work together to maintain a decentralized network where no single entity controls the system. However, the blockchain itself is only one piece of the puzzle.

2. Wallets: The Gateways to Blockchain Interaction

Wallets are vital for interacting with a blockchain, as they provide users with a way to store, send, and receive cryptocurrencies and tokens securely. Each wallet includes a private key, which proves ownership of the assets associated with it.

Types of Wallets:

  • Software Wallets: Digital applications (desktop, mobile, or web-based) like MetaMask or Trust Wallet.
  • Hardware Wallets: Physical devices like D’cent or Ledger that offer extra security by storing private keys offline.

How Wallets Strengthen the Blockchain:

  • Secure Asset Management: By safeguarding private keys, wallets ensure secure access to blockchain assets, preventing unauthorized access.
  • User Engagement: Wallets provide easy access to blockchain networks, encouraging user adoption and participation.
  • Decentralization: By allowing users to store their own assets, wallets reduce reliance on centralized exchanges, thus promoting the ethos of decentralization.

3. The Role of Hardware Wallets: Maximizing Security

While software wallets are convenient, they can be vulnerable to hacking. Hardware wallets, like D'cent, offer a more secure alternative. These devices store private keys offline, meaning they are immune to malware attacks, phishing, or other online threats.

Key Benefits of Hardware Wallets:

  • Offline Protection: Since hardware wallets are disconnected from the internet, they are significantly less susceptible to hacking.
  • Backup and Recovery: Devices like D'cent often come with recovery options through seed phrases, ensuring users can recover funds even if the wallet is lost or damaged.
  • Integration with dApps: Many hardware wallets can integrate with decentralized apps and platforms, ensuring users can interact with DeFi applications securely.

How Hardware Wallets Strengthen the Ecosystem:

  • Enhanced Security: Hardware wallets protect the ecosystem from potential breaches, instilling greater trust among users.
  • Widespread Adoption: Increased security and user control over assets make blockchain technology more appealing to mainstream users and institutional investors alike.

4. Miners, Validators, and Nodes: Keeping the Blockchain Running

Miners (in Proof of Work) and validators (in Proof of Stake) are essential participants who ensure the network's functionality by verifying and recording transactions.

Contributions to Blockchain:

  • Security: Miners and validators protect the network by verifying transactions and ensuring they follow the consensus rules.
  • Decentralization: By distributing the responsibility of maintaining the network, the ecosystem becomes more resistant to attacks.
  • Economic Incentives: Through mining or staking rewards, blockchain networks encourage participation, which strengthens the entire infrastructure.

How Miners and Validators Strengthen Wallets:

  • Transaction Confirmation: Wallets rely on miners and validators to ensure that transactions are added to the blockchain securely and promptly.
  • Reduced Transaction Times: As miners and validators increase, transaction throughput improves, benefiting users who rely on wallets for faster interactions.

5. Exchanges: Facilitating Liquidity and Growth

Cryptocurrency exchanges play a crucial role in the blockchain ecosystem by providing liquidity. They allow users to buy, sell, and trade various cryptocurrencies, tokens, and other blockchain assets.

Key Contributions:

  • Liquidity: Exchanges make it easy for users to convert their digital assets into fiat or other cryptocurrencies, which strengthens the blockchain’s economic utility.
  • Price Discovery: By facilitating transactions, exchanges help determine the value of cryptocurrencies, impacting the health and growth of the network.

Integration with Wallets:

  • Interoperability: Wallets often integrate directly with exchanges to provide users with a seamless trading experience. Users can store funds in a secure wallet and trade them without needing to move their assets onto a centralized exchange platform.
  • Security and Flexibility: Through decentralized exchanges (DEXs), users can trade directly from their wallets, eliminating the need for middlemen, which further strengthens decentralization.

6. dApps and Smart Contracts: Enabling Real-World Use Cases

Decentralized applications (dApps) and smart contracts are the foundation for many blockchain use cases, from decentralized finance (DeFi) to gaming, supply chain tracking, and beyond.

Contributions to Blockchain Growth:

  • Increased Utility: By offering real-world use cases, dApps drive more users to the blockchain, fostering greater network effects.
  • Automation and Trust: Smart contracts remove intermediaries and automatically execute transactions, enhancing the efficiency and trustworthiness of the ecosystem.

dApps and Wallets:

  • Direct Access: Many wallets, like MetaMask, serve as a portal to the world of dApps, allowing users to interact with decentralized services directly. Hardware wallets like D’cent offer secure, hardware-level interaction with dApps, ensuring that private keys remain safe even when engaging in complex DeFi activities.
  • Ecosystem Synergy: As more dApps emerge, the demand for secure, user-friendly wallets grows. Wallets, in turn, make it easier for users to engage with these applications, creating a self-reinforcing cycle of growth.

7. Developers and Governance: The Backbone of Blockchain Evolution

The blockchain space thrives on innovation, and developers are its driving force. Developers contribute by creating new protocols, dApps, and improvements to existing systems. Governance structures, such as DAOs (Decentralized Autonomous Organizations), also allow stakeholders to participate in decision-making.

Contributions to Blockchain Strength:

  • Innovation: Developers keep the ecosystem dynamic by creating new functionalities and ensuring scalability.
  • Governance: DAOs and other decentralized governance models empower the community to vote on important network changes.

Synergy with Wallets:

  • Security Updates: Wallets benefit from ongoing security improvements and updates developed by the community, making them more resilient to new threats.
  • Community Involvement: Governance tokens are often held in wallets, allowing users to participate in decisions affecting the blockchain network, promoting community-driven growth.
